We took a quiet one hour plus a bit run in our 1986 Thundercraft and being new at boating were pleased with how well all went.
However when I took out the drain plug on loading boat on trailer watched as a steady stream of water drained from the boat.
Not sure if I need professional help or some things I could check myself.
Looking for your advice please.
 
Need more info,type of hull,Was boat covered,First trip this year in boat,Did it rain day before,possible compartments draining into bilge. If possible fill deck with water and check outside hull for seepage.hope this helps.
 
It's a fiberglass boat ... 16 foot Thundercraft bowrider and it was our first outing ever in this boat.
It had rained some the night before and we only had a tarp over the boat which could contribute to the problem.

If this is an inboard/outboard, carefully inspect the water lines and bellows between the outdrive and the motor. These are often responsible for these type boats taking on water and sinking.
